Tenant lost the right to exercise the renewal option because, as at 31 July 2007, he was in arrears and had a persistent history of late payment amounting to failure of the condition precedent; additionally the tenant's pleaded denial of the landlord's title constituted repudiation fatal to the tenant's position; section 58 did not apply because the lease expired by effluxion of time once the option was lost. Therefore the landlord's Order 14 relief in paragraphs (1) and (4) succeeds.
